The company wants to build the infrastructure needed to integrate air travel into congested urban centers as an alternative to stop-and-go car trips.<\/p>\n<p>In its search for vertiports, the company is looking for busy surface routes \u201cwhere it should take 30 minutes to get from point A to point B, but it takes an hour and a half,\u201d Cox said. <\/p>\n<p>\u201cSouthern California area has got a lot of challenges in terms of congestion on the roadway,\u201d he said.<\/p>\n<p>            <img class=\"image\" alt=\"Flying taxi created by Joby Aviation at the Grove in the Fairfax District in Los Angeles last year.\"   width=\"1200\" height=\"800\" src=\"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/us\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/10\/1759493715_275_\" dec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\"\/>         <\/p>\n<p>Cleo Sinnott, 3, left, and her sister Maja, 2, from Sydney, Australia, visit with a flying taxi created by Joby Aviation at the Grove in the Fairfax District in Los Angeles last year.<\/p>\n<p>(Genaro Molina \/ Los Angeles Times)<\/p>\n<p>California has several startups working on electric vertical takeoff and landing (eVTOL) aircraft, which were designed to bring the benefits of helicopter travel to the masses, with a significantly lower noise level than conventional helicopters, a highly anticipated technological advancement for many.<\/p>\n<p>LA28, the committee charged with planning L.A.\u2019s third Summer Games, is partnering with San Jos\u00e9-based aerospace company Archer Aviation to assemble <a class=\"link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.latimes.com\/business\/story\/2025-05-15\/la28-electric-air-taxis-car-free-olympics\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">a fleet of electric air taxis<\/a> designed in the hope of diverting even a tiny slice of Olympics traffic to the sky, Archer said in May.<\/p>\n<p>Archer hopes its air taxis will offer 10- to 20-minute flights using a network of vertiports throughout the city, including at SoFi Stadium, LAX and other hubs from Santa Monica to Orange County.<\/p>\n<p>Cox declined to specify potential vertiport locations the company is considering in Southern California for competitive reasons. Still, he expects \u201ctwo or three dozen scattered around the market that will truly transform how people move through and between cities.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Ideal locations would be in urban centers where there are clusters of offices and stores in close proximity to dense residential neighborhoods, all surrounded by heavy traffic year-round. The Los Angeles region has several busy centers that fit that description, such as Santa Monica, downtown L.A. and Culver City.<\/p>\n<p>Vertiports by Atlantic has hired real estate brokerage Cushman &amp; Wakefield to find sites to lease in some of the nation\u2019s largest markets, including California, New York, New Jersey and Florida. <\/p>\n<p>Targets include the Greater Los Angeles area, the San Francisco Bay Area, New York City and its outer boroughs, Long Island, Newark, Broward and Miami-Dade counties, Orlando and Tampa. <\/p>\n<p>The company plans to start securing sites by the end of the year.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cBasically, we\u2019re trying to find the bus stops for flying taxis,\u201d commercial property broker Mike Condon Jr. said. \u201cThis is George Jetson-esque. This is the future here, now.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The flying cars of \u201cThe Jetsons,\u201d a futuristic animated sitcom that enchanted television audiences in the early 1960s, are \u201cnot a bad analogy,\u201d Cox said. However, the taxis will be flown by professional pilots instead of heads of households like George Jetson. \u201cIt\u2019s that kind of leap in technology.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>That also means cities haven\u2019t got regulations on the books about how they can be used.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e real challenge for these is getting local land use entitlements,\u201d Condon said. \u201cThere\u2019s nowhere in zoning codes that says how flying taxis can take off.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>            <img class=\"image\" alt=\"Artist rendering of a flying taxi landing site. \"   width=\"1200\" height=\"675\" src=\"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/us\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/10\/1759493716_259_\" dec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\"\/>         <\/p>\n<p>Artist rendering of a flying taxi landing site. <\/p>\n<p>(VertiPorts by Atlantic)<\/p>\n<p>VertiPorts by Atlantic is a subsidiary of Atlantic Aviation, which already operates a network of private plane terminals at airports that could also be used by eVTOLs.
